Re: Sentinel LSS - Trip Report

Quote: (Originally Posted by Ilikerisk) View Original Post
Does anyone from the trip have opinions about trim and hydrodynamics?

Hi Ilikerisk,

The trim and hydrodynamics are subjective but I found the face down position to be the most comfortable when diving the Sentinel LSS and a right hand angle would encourage the ADV to fire and a left hand position would require slightly more demand to make it fire. Although those positions still had very comfortable WOB, swimming on your back was for me not the most comfortable probably due to the back mounted 4.5ltr counterlung but it was still OK.

The mouthpiece took a bit of adjusting to get it to sit just right and also to make it feel comfortable as it does have the BOV fitted and the loop hoses are push fit into the head so marking the right position for you when you have found it is a good idea. The BOV was very easy to use and it has a very nice action to operate it from the CC position to the OC position and the Poseidon gives a lot of gas but it is best to keep it mouthpiece down when removing it to prevent any free flows the BOV should be fed directly from the inboard fist stage regulator to ensure compliance with the CE Standard as the Manual Inject / Switch Block may cause a flow restriction at depth but I am going to run it that way in the future and see how it goes.

Taking it for a couple of dives this Saturday so I will see how it feels in the not so warm waters of an Irish Lough.
